How they compare
Angola currently reports 0.0026 thousand cubic feet per capita per day against 0.002 thousand cubic feet per capita per day in Ecuador, a difference of 0.0006 thousand cubic feet per capita per day.
That makes Angola's figure about 1.3 times Ecuador's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 39 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Angola ahead.
Angola ranks 105th and Ecuador ranks 107th of 194 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Angola averaged higher in 3 and Ecuador in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Angola | Ecuador |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0.0035 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0009 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0027 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| Angola |
| 1990s | 0.004 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0009 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0031 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| Angola |
| 2000s | 0.0033 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0015 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0019 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| Angola |
| 2010s | 0.0024 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0027 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| 0.0003 thousand cubic feet per capita per day | Ecuador |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Per capita data has been generated by World Bank staff by taking Energy consumption data [U.S EIA] and applying country population data from the World Bank Group - World Development Indicators.
